are hujeta and south american gars the same fish?
 
hujeta's go by lots of names, and they're not true gars either. the are commonly called rocket gars, hujeta gars, freshwater barracuda, south american gars, and plenty others.

they're fun fish, i have three, can't get them off of live no matter how I starve them, well, except for blood worms, two of the three will take bloodworms.
 
lots of people have true gars that eat pellets but most characins are pretty picky
